Joining Process
We do not "choose" new members of our cohousing community. We ask rather that you choose us thoughtfully by taking the time to get to know us and by reviewing our community agreements and decisions to date to be certain you wish to commit to them. This self-selection process has proven to work very well for cohousing, and the group was founded on that principle. We are a cohesive group that works well together, cares about each other, and is effective in making decisions together; we all self-selected. For self-selection to work, people must go through a series of steps that help them figure out whether this is a good fit, and whether they are financially able and prepared to participate. Here are the steps most people take from initial interest to deciding to join us. (fyi: committed households are called "Members" which comes from the fact that we are all members of a member-managed LLC -- the legal business entity developing the project). 1. - Come to a public event, social event, orientation, or business meeting. Upcoming dates listed here. 2. - Join as an Associate of the group. An intensive learning phase. As an Associate you have full access to all the detailed information you would need to evaluate the merits of the project (including detailed architectural plans, project budget schedule and financing info) as well as access to the group's internal listserv and Yahoo Group. Associates are able to participate in the discussion process leading to decisions, but they do not have the right to block decisions, a right which is reserved for full Members. 3 - Join as a full, financially committed Member. 1) already be an Associate Upon joining you will select an apartment. Should additional apartments become available later in the process, Members may change their selections and at all times have priority over people who have not yet become members.
